RIA Compliance Risk: Proactive Monitoring Strategies

Effectively managing legal risk for Registered Investment Advisors (RIAs) necessitates a comprehensive approach to monitoring. Simply reacting to violations isn't enough; firms must implement ongoing, forward-looking strategies. This involves establishing a program for continuously evaluating advisor activities, client communications, and investment records. Key elements of a successful strategy include:

  • Implementing automated tools to detect potential compliance issues.
  • Regularly reviewing advisor procedures for adherence to firm policies and applicable regulations.
  • Conducting scheduled audits of client files and communication .
  • Establishing a established reporting process for advisors to escalate concerns .
  • Providing ongoing education to advisors on compliance requirements and ethical standards .

By embracing these techniques, RIAs can significantly lower their exposure to financial penalties and preserve their standing .
